Jerry Edwards - "Vol
is playing very well right now. Coming off of a series sweep they will
be playing with a lot of confidence. They have some good young talent, with
a good mix of sophomores. Coach Smith will have his guys ready to play. They
always play us tough and this weekend will be no different.
We have to do a better job at the plate. We need to get guys on base early so we can try to run and play our style of game. We need to be able to execute better and get some timely two out hits. We will need to get three quality starts and be able to keep Watkins off the bases, so their middle guys are hitting with no one on base. We also need a better defensive perfor-mance this weekend. Last weekend we gave up five unearned runs out of a total of thirteen runs scored. Vol will be a tough opponent and we will have to play nearly perfect to have a chance to get at least one win. " |
Jeff Smith - "Going
to Hiwassee will be a chal-lenge for us. Coach Edwards will have his team
pumped up and ready to play. This should be a very good series. We must
continue to improve offensively and defensively. If we are able to play
error free baseball and effectively pitch, then we should have chance in all
three games. With a road record of 2-5 and a 3-3 conference record this is a
must series for us to get back where we want to be in the standings and from a confidence stand point. " |

Series Highlights -Outstanding spectator series to watch this weekend.
Both teams played extremely well and battled toe to toe. Timely
defense and hitting on Friday pulled the Eagles through in Game 1 and the
same can be said for Walters State on Saturday for Games 2 and 3. Would
like to add that Walters State this weekend played the entire series
without their head coach Ken Campbell who had to be hospitalized early
Friday morning with a kidney stone. We wish Coach Campbell a speedy
recovery.
